Feta Baked Pasta


Preparation time: 10 minutes
Cook time: 30 minutes
Total time: 40 minutes
Yield: 4 Servings

Ingredients:
  • 16 oz. Cherry tomatoes (or canned diced tomatoes)
  • 4-5 Cloves Fresh chopped garlic
  • 4-5 Tbsp. Olive Oil
  • 1 tsp. Dried Italian seasoning (Can substitute basil, oregano, thyme, parsley )
  • To taste Red pepper flakes, optional
  • Salt and pepper (To taste)
  • 1/2 Cup Tomato sauce (Marinara is better)
  • 2 Tbsp. Grated parmesan cheese
  • Fresh basil, optional
  • 8 oz. dry pasta, Recommend curly pasta: rotini, radiatori
  • 9 oz. Feta Block

Directions:
  1. Preheat your oven to 400 degrees. 
  2. In a 9" x 9" baking pan, add your feta block (drained) in the center. Add the tomatoes around it. Sprinkle your chopped garlic over feta and tomatoes.
  3. Drizzle 2-3 tablespoons of olive oil all over the cheese and tomatoes. Sprinkle seasoning on top.
  4. Bake for 30 minutes or until the cheese feels soft.
  5. While baking, boil water and cook your pasta then drain.
  6. Take out your feta tomato dish lightly mash with a fork or potato masher. Add your drained pasta.
  7. Optional: add your favorite tomato sauce, drizzle with more olive oil, add fresh basil and parmesan cheese.
